Ada, together with her nine-year-old illegitimate daughter Flora, and her piano, leave Scotland to arrive in the remote bush of 19th-century New Zealand for a marriage arranged by her father. Although mute, she does not consider herself silent as her piano is the vehicle of her expression.
Jane Campion's The Piano is one of the most unusual love stories in the history of cinema. The film swept the world upon its release, winning awards for its performances, script, and direction, including prestigious Cannes and Academy Award prizes. Rejecting virtually every stereotype of the romance genre, it poses a wholly new set of questions ...
In films that are sharply focused on singular women, Jane Campion has gained worldwide admiration and respect. Her films include "Sweetie", "An Angel At My Table" and "The Piano". In this collection of interviews she talks about her work.

Based on the 1999 film, HOLY SMOKE is about Ruth, the rebellious daughter in an Australian family, who falls under the spell of an Indian guru. The family hires a man who specializes in "de-programming" such gullible victims, but when he confronts Ruth in the Australian bush, events take an unexpected turn.
